摘要
Supramolecular [Cu(II)(ONQ)(2)(H2O)(2)](n) (1) a complex of the 2-hydroxy-1,4-naphthoquinone ligand (2HNQ), has been synthesized using CuCl2 . 2H(2)O. ONQ is the deprotonated oxidized form of the ligand (viz. 2-oxido-1,4-naphthoquinone). The complex has been characterised by X-ray crystallography, variable temperature magnetic susceptibility measurements (SQUID), EPR and CV studies. The crystal structure of 1 has been solved at 295 and 161 K. The cell volume decreases from 435.3(6) Angstrom(3) at 295 K to 427.9(6) Angstrom(3) at 161 K. The monomeric units of 1 are linked by three types of intermolecular hydrogen bondings through coordinated ONQ ligands and water molecules, which results in a supramolecular three dimensional hydrogen bonding network. The magnetic susceptibility data of I were best fitted with the Bonner Fisher equation with the coupling parameter J = -3.2 cm(-1), indicating a weak antiferromagnetic interaction along the chain.
